Antipasto A Wonderful Dish to Nibble On! |
 |
 |
1 cup ripe olives 1/4 cup chopped green olives 1 cup chopped pickled onions 1/4 cup cooking oil 1 small chopped green pepper 1 cup chopped cauliflower 2 1/4 cups ketchup 12 oz chopped mixed pickles 1 lb. chopped, cooked mushrooms 7 oz. canned tuna lemon juice salt and pepper
|
Any ingredients that need chopping should be finely chopped.
Put the olives, onions, oil, green pepper and cauliflower in a saucepan and bring to a boil over medium heat.
Simmer for 10 minutes and then add the next 3 ingredients.
Return to a boil and then simmer for 10 more minutes. Stir often so that the mixture does not stick.
Add the tuna, remove from heat and chill for several hours.
Add a little lemom juice if you would like it a bit sharper. Salt and pepper to taste.
